Preparing for Your Lash Extension Appointment

 Your Lash Extension Guide

Lash extensions are a popular beauty treatment that can enhance the natural beauty of your eyes. They can give you longer, fuller lashes without the need for mascara or falsies. However, to get the best results from your lash extension appointment, there are a few things you should do to prepare. In this blog, we will provide you with tips and tricks on how to prepare for your lash extension appointment.

1. Research the Salon and Technician

Before booking your lash extension appointment, do your research. Look for salons that specialize in lash extensions and have positive reviews from previous customers. Additionally, make sure the technician who will be applying your lash extensions is certified and has experience in the field. You want to make sure you’re in good hands and will receive high-quality service.

2. Cleanse Your Face and Lashes

Before your appointment, make sure to cleanse your face and lashes thoroughly. Remove any makeup or oil from your lashes and eyelids using a gentle cleanser. This will help to ensure that your lash extensions adhere properly to your natural lashes. Avoid using any oil-based products around your eyes as they can affect the adhesive used for the lash extensions.

3. Don’t Wear Contacts

If you wear contact lenses, it’s best to leave them at home on the day of your appointment. Wearing contacts can be uncomfortable during the procedure, and they may need to be removed anyway. Additionally, it’s important to avoid touching your eyes during the first 24 hours after your lash extension appointment, and this can be difficult if you’re used to wearing contacts.

4. Avoid Caffeine and Alcohol

It’s best to avoid caffeine and alcohol before your appointment, as they can cause your eyes to be more sensitive. You want to make sure your eyes are as comfortable as possible during the procedure, and caffeine and alcohol can make them more sensitive and twitchy.

5. Arrive on Time

Arrive at your appointment on time, or even a few minutes early. This will give you time to fill out any necessary paperwork and have a consultation with your technician. Additionally, if you’re running late, you may feel rushed during the procedure, which can make it more difficult for the technician to apply the lash extensions.

6. Communicate Your Preferences

During the consultation with your technician, make sure to communicate your preferences. Do you want a natural look or a more dramatic one? Do you prefer a certain lash length or thickness? Your technician can help guide you and make recommendations based on your natural lashes and the look you’re going for.

7. Avoid Water and Steam

After your lash extension appointment, it’s important to avoid water and steam for the first 24-48 hours. This includes swimming, saunas, and hot showers. Water and steam can affect the adhesive used for the lash extensions and cause them to fall out prematurely.

8. Avoid Touching Your Eyes

It’s important to avoid touching your eyes during the first 24 hours after your lash extension appointment. This includes rubbing your eyes, sleeping on your face, and applying any eye makeup. Touching your eyes can cause the lash extensions to fall out prematurely or become misaligned.
